- W26557645 abstract "Many new cardiovascular medications have become a mainstay of therapy for patients who undergo anaesthesia for both cardiac and non-cardiac surgery. In general, most of these medications should be continued in their usual doses up to and including the morning of surgery, and should then be re-instituted in the early postoperative period. It is important to appreciate the potential for drug interactions with the anaesthetic agents, as well as other cardioactive medications which may be administered perioperatively. In addition, a number of new, short-acting medications such as esmolol and adenosine, appear to be pharmacologically tailored for the perioperative control of tachycardia, arrhythmias and haemodynamic pertubations. Consideration of efficacy, ease of administration, side-effect profile, and cost-benefit (pharmacoeconomic) aspects will determine the ultimate role of all these new medications in our clinical practice." @default.
